| Question | Answer |
|---|---|
| What is pharmacodynamics? | The study of how drugs affect the body. |
| What is Pharmacokinetics? | The study of how drugs are introduced into the body. |
| What is Pharmacotherapeutics? | The study of how drugs are used in the treatment of a disease. |
| What is Posology? | The study of the exact amount of a drug needed for a therapeutic effect. |
| What is Toxicology? | The study of harmful effects of drugs on the body. |
| What is Adverse Affects? | Instances when there is an undesirable and potentially hazardous effect after ingestion of the drug. |
| What is an Agonsit? | A drug that binds to a specific receptor on a cell, typically called a target cell. |
| What is an Antagonist? | An inhibitor, a drug that counteracts, or provides the opposite effect of an agonist. |
| What is a chemical name? | Chemical composition of a specific drug. |
| What are contraindications? | A term stating that a specific drug or combo of drugs should not be used by a person or class of people because the use may have a dangerous and possibly fatal effect. |
| What is a dose? | The exact amount of a drug to produce adesirable effect. |
| What is the drug indication? | Exact reason for the use of the drug. |
| What is a drug? | Any chemical substance that, when ingested,injected or applied to skin or any other administration will caues a specific change in the body. |
| What is the Generic Name? | Drugs are released into the market with 2 names. Generic is more appropriatley used for the exact name of the drug. |
| What is OTC? | Availible to the public without a prescription. |
| What is MOA(Mechanism of Action)? | How a drug works or, after the drug is ingested what effects will it have on the body (good or bad) |
